Abstract

The utility model discloses a high-concentration fluorine-containing wastewater advanced treatment device which comprises a mixing box, a filtering tank and a settling box, wherein a rotating rod is installed at one end inside the mixing box through a bearing, a stirring plate is welded on the outer side of the rotating rod, a driving motor is installed at the top of the mixing box through an installation frame, a water suction pump is fixed at one side of the driving motor through a bolt, a chemical box is fixed at one end of the top of the mixing box through a bolt, a discharging pipe is connected to the bottom end of the chemical box through a thread groove, the discharging pipe penetrates through the mixing box, a sealing inserting plate is sleeved at one side of the discharging pipe, and a compression spring is fixed between the sealing inserting plate and the mixing box through a bolt. The utility model has simple integral structure, and can effectively treat the high-concentration fluorine-containing wastewater by adding the lime milk and the fluorine-containing wastewater to stir and mix to ensure that the wastewater is completely alkaline and then precipitating and filtering.

Background
Fluorine pollution refers to environmental pollution caused by fluorine and compounds thereof, mainly comes from emissions in aluminum smelting, phosphate ore processing, phosphate fertilizer production, steel smelting and coal combustion processes, fluorine is accumulated as a domestic animal poison, plant leaves and pasture can absorb fluorine, livestock such as cattle and sheep eat the polluted food, and joint swelling, hoof nail lengthening and bone quality are caused: the traditional Chinese medicine composition is loosened and cannot be laid down, and the excessive fluorine intake of a person can interfere the activities of various enzymes in the body, destroy the metabolic balance of calcium and phosphorus, and cause fluorosis diseases with the symptoms of brittle teeth nephew, plaque formation, bone and joint deformation and the like.

It should be noted that the utility model is a high-concentration fluorine-containing wastewater advanced treatment device, when in work, a person uses a power cord to connect a driving motor 5 and a water pump 6 with an external power supply, lime milk is poured into a chemical box 4, fluorine-containing wastewater enters a filter tank 2 through a pipeline and is filtered by a filter screen 16, the filter screen 16 can filter impurities and particles in the fluorine-containing wastewater, the filtered fluorine-containing wastewater enters a mixing box 1, a first baffle 15 can block the filtered impurities and particles to enable the filtered impurities and particles to fall into the filter tank 2, the person opens a tank cover 7 to clean the impurities and the particles, the lime milk in the chemical box 4 falls into the mixing box 1 through a discharge pipe 10, the person opens the driving motor 5 to drive a stirring rod 14 to rotate to stir and mix the lime milk and the fluorine-containing wastewater, the person opens the water pump 6 to pump the mixed fluorine-containing wastewater into a settling box 3 to settle, the settled fluorine-containing waste water overflows the second partition plate 17 and is filtered by the first filter block 18 and the second filter block 19, the fluorine-containing waste water can be effectively treated, when the fluorine-containing waste water flows into the mixing box 1, the plurality of poking plates 9 on the outer sides of the rotating rods 8 can be pushed to rotate, the poking plates 9 rotate to drive the sealing plugboard 11 to move through the poking blocks 13, when the sealing plugboard 11 is moved out of the blanking pipe 10, lime milk in the chemical box 4 can flow into the mixing box 1 through the blanking pipe 10, after the poking plates 9 rotate to leave the poking blocks 13, the compression springs 12 push the sealing plugboard 11 to insert into the blanking pipe 10, plugging is carried out in the blanking pipe 10, and the amount of the lime milk can be controlled according to the amount of the fluorine-containing waste water entering the mixing box 1.
